What Is an Ischemic Stroke?

An ischemic stroke accounts for roughly 87% of all strokes, making it far more common than the other major type, hemorrhagic stroke, which occurs when a blood vessel ruptures rather than becomes blocked. During an ischemic stroke, a clot or fatty deposit obstructs an artery feeding the brain. Brain tissue downstream of that blockage is starved of oxygen and nutrients, and without rapid treatment, that tissue can be permanently damaged.

Every 40 seconds, someone in the United States has a stroke, and more than 795,000 people experience a new or recurrent stroke each year, according to the CDC’s Stroke Facts. The vast majority of those events are ischemic in nature, which is exactly why understanding the mechanism behind them matters so much for prevention.

There are two main categories of ischemic stroke:

Cerebral Thrombosis

This occurs when a blood clot (thrombus) forms directly inside an artery that has already been narrowed by plaque buildup, a condition called atherosclerosis. The clot grows large enough to block blood flow at that exact location in the brain.

Cerebral Embolism

This happens when a clot forms somewhere else in the body — often in the heart — and then travels through the bloodstream until it lodges in a smaller brain artery. Irregular heart rhythms, especially atrial fibrillation, are one of the most common sources of these traveling clots.

A brief version of an ischemic stroke, called a transient ischemic attack (TIA) or “mini-stroke,” happens when the blockage clears on its own within minutes. A TIA should never be dismissed — it is frequently the earliest warning sign that a larger, more damaging stroke may follow. What Causes Ischemic Stroke? The Root Mechanism

At its core, every ischemic stroke traces back to something interrupting blood flow to the brain. The most frequent underlying cause is atherosclerosis — the slow, often silent buildup of cholesterol and fatty plaque inside artery walls. Over years, this plaque can narrow an artery enough to choke off blood flow on its own, or it can rupture and trigger a clot that finishes the job. Other, less common causes include:

  • Blood clotting disorders that make the blood more prone to forming clots
  • Inflammation of blood vessels (vasculitis)
  • Dissection, or a small tear, in an artery wall supplying the brain
  • Severe dehydration or blood-thickening conditions
  • Certain infections that affect blood vessel health

Because the causes of an ischemic stroke are so closely tied to the health of your blood vessels and heart, the risk factors below overlap heavily with cardiovascular disease. In fact, research on population-attributable risk has found that a relatively short list of well-known risk factors — hypertension, atrial fibrillation, physical inactivity, low HDL cholesterol, smoking, diabetes, and a few others — together account for nearly all of the risk of having an ischemic stroke in the first place.

8 Major Risk Factors for Ischemic Stroke

Some risk factors for ischemic stroke can be modified through lifestyle changes and medical treatment, while others cannot. The table below summarizes the most significant ones.

Risk Factor Type Why It Matters
High blood pressure Modifiable The single leading cause of stroke; damages and weakens artery walls over time
Atrial fibrillation / heart disease Modifiable Allows clots to form in the heart and travel to the brain
High cholesterol Modifiable Drives plaque buildup (atherosclerosis) inside brain-supplying arteries
Diabetes Modifiable Damages blood vessels and accelerates plaque formation
Smoking or vaping Modifiable Thickens blood and damages vessel linings
Obesity / sedentary lifestyle Modifiable Raises blood pressure, cholesterol, and diabetes risk simultaneously
Prior stroke or TIA Non-modifiable (but manageable) Significantly raises the chance of a repeat, often more severe, event
Age, family history, and sickle cell disease Non-modifiable Genetics and age naturally increase vulnerability

1. High Blood Pressure

High blood pressure is considered the leading cause of stroke. Roughly three-quarters of people who have a stroke have hypertension, and it is often called the single most potent modifiable risk factor for both ischemic stroke and hemorrhagic stroke. Over time, uncontrolled blood pressure weakens and damages artery walls throughout the body, including the vessels that feed the brain, making them far more likely to narrow, tear, or clot.

2. Atrial Fibrillation and Heart Disease

An irregular heartbeat allows blood to pool and clot inside the heart’s chambers. Those clots can break free and travel directly to the brain, causing an embolic ischemic stroke. People with atrial fibrillation face a substantially higher risk of stroke than the general population, which is why heart-rhythm monitoring is such a routine part of a neurologic workup after any stroke-like event.

3. High Cholesterol

Excess LDL (“bad”) cholesterol builds up as plaque along artery walls, gradually narrowing the vessels that supply the brain and setting the stage for a clot to form. Low HDL (“good”) cholesterol has also been linked to a meaningfully higher stroke risk, which is why cholesterol management usually looks at the full lipid panel rather than a single number.

4. Diabetes

Diabetes damages blood vessels over time and frequently coexists with high blood pressure and high cholesterol, compounding stroke risk substantially. Poor long-term blood sugar control is associated with a higher likelihood of stroke, and the risk climbs the longer someone has lived with unmanaged diabetes.

5. Smoking and Vaping

Nicotine and other chemicals in cigarettes and vaping products damage the lining of blood vessels and make the blood more likely to clot. Smokers face a meaningfully higher risk of ischemic stroke than non-smokers, and that risk begins dropping fairly quickly after quitting.

6. Obesity and a Sedentary Lifestyle

Carrying excess weight and getting little physical activity raises blood pressure, cholesterol, and blood sugar all at once — a combination that compounds stroke risk. On the flip side, people who stay physically active tend to have a notably lower risk of stroke than those who are largely sedentary, which is one of the more encouraging findings in stroke research.

7. Previous Stroke or TIA

If you’ve already had a stroke or TIA, your risk of a second, potentially more damaging event is meaningfully higher, which makes ongoing neurology follow-up essential. This is one of the strongest predictors of future stroke risk in the medical literature, and it’s a major reason specialists recommend structured follow-up rather than a single ER visit and no further monitoring.

8. Family History and Age

Stroke risk rises with age, and having a close relative who has had a stroke increases your own likelihood of experiencing one, even after accounting for lifestyle factors. Certain inherited conditions, such as sickle cell disease, also raise risk independently of the other factors on this list.

Recognize the Warning Signs Early

Ischemic strokes strike suddenly, and every minute without treatment increases the risk of lasting brain damage. Watch for these symptoms, even if they come and go:

  • Sudden weakness or numbness on one side of the face, arm, or leg
  • Trouble speaking or understanding words
  • Sudden vision loss or blurriness
  • Dizziness, imbalance, or sudden trouble walking
  • An intense, sudden headache with no known cause

Use the FAST test: Face drooping, Arm weakness, Speech difficulty, Time to call 911. How Ischemic Stroke Is Diagnosed

When someone arrives at the hospital with possible stroke symptoms, doctors move quickly. Diagnosis of an ischemic stroke typically involves:

  • A rapid neurological exam to assess speech, strength, vision, and coordination
  • CT or MRI brain imaging to confirm a blockage and rule out bleeding
  • Blood tests to check clotting factors, blood sugar, and infection markers
  • Heart monitoring (EKG) to check for atrial fibrillation or other rhythm problems
  • Imaging of the carotid arteries in the neck to look for narrowing

A specialist review of these CT, MRI, and hospital reports afterward is just as important as the initial diagnosis, since it shapes your long-term prevention plan. It’s also the step that helps rule out other causes, such as intracerebral hemorrhage — a bleeding stroke that requires very different treatment. Treatment Options for Ischemic Stroke

Because an ischemic stroke is caused by a blockage, treatment is focused on restoring blood flow as quickly as possible. Options include:

  • Clot-busting medication (tPA/thrombolytics): Given intravenously to dissolve the clot, typically most effective within the first few hours of symptom onset
  • Mechanical clot removal (thrombectomy): A minimally invasive procedure in which a catheter is used to physically remove the clot from a large brain artery
  • Antiplatelet or anticoagulant medication: Used both acutely and long-term to reduce the chance of future clots
  • Blood pressure and cholesterol management: Ongoing medical treatment to reduce the underlying causes of clot formation

Even brief symptoms that resolve on their own can represent a TIA, which is often the final warning before a major stroke — a fast evaluation in these cases can prevent lifelong disability.

Why Time Matters So Much in Ischemic Stroke Care

Brain tissue is remarkably time-sensitive. Every minute an ischemic stroke goes untreated, millions of neurons can be lost. That’s the entire rationale behind the “time is brain” philosophy that emergency neurology is built around, and it’s why recognizing symptoms immediately — rather than waiting to see if they pass — genuinely changes outcomes.

Preventing an Ischemic Stroke

Because so many risk factors for ischemic stroke are modifiable, prevention is genuinely within reach for most people. Effective strategies include:

  • Keeping blood pressure and cholesterol within a healthy range through medication and diet
  • Managing diabetes closely with your doctor
  • Quitting smoking and avoiding vaping products
  • Building regular physical activity into your week
  • Treating atrial fibrillation or other heart rhythm disorders
  • Scheduling a neurology evaluation if you’ve had any TIA symptoms, however brief

Life After an Ischemic Stroke

Recovery from an ischemic stroke varies widely depending on the size and location of the affected brain area, as well as how quickly treatment began. Common post-stroke challenges include:

  • Weakness or paralysis, often on one side of the body
  • Speech and language difficulties
  • Vision changes
  • Memory or concentration problems
  • Emotional changes, including depression or anxiety

Rehabilitation — including physical, occupational, and speech therapy — plays a major role in recovery, and ongoing neurology care helps monitor for and manage post-stroke symptoms as they evolve. Frequently Asked Questions About Ischemic Stroke

What is the main cause of ischemic stroke?

The most common underlying cause is atherosclerosis, a buildup of fatty plaque inside the arteries that either narrows the vessel directly or triggers a clot that blocks blood flow to the brain.

Can an ischemic stroke be reversed?

If treated within the first few hours with clot-busting medication or mechanical clot removal, some or all of the damage can be limited or reversed. This is why recognizing symptoms and seeking emergency care quickly is so critical.

What is the difference between ischemic and hemorrhagic stroke?

An ischemic stroke is caused by a blockage in a blood vessel, while a hemorrhagic stroke is caused by a blood vessel rupturing and bleeding into or around the brain. Ischemic stroke is far more common, accounting for the large majority of strokes.

Is ischemic stroke hereditary?

Family history can raise your risk, but most cases are driven by a combination of genetics and modifiable factors like blood pressure, cholesterol, and lifestyle habits.

How long does recovery from an ischemic stroke take?

Recovery timelines vary widely. Some patients see significant improvement within weeks, while others continue to improve for months or years with ongoing rehabilitation and neurology follow-up.

Can a TIA turn into a full ischemic stroke?

Yes. A TIA is often an early warning sign, and patients who experience one are at meaningfully higher risk of a full ischemic stroke in the days and weeks that follow, which makes prompt evaluation essential.

How can I lower my ischemic stroke risk starting today?

Start with the modifiable risk factors: get your blood pressure and cholesterol checked, ask about diabetes screening, quit smoking or vaping, add regular movement to your week, and schedule a neurology evaluation if you’ve ever had TIA-like symptoms.
